Dakota State University has a variety of courses to offer at the undergraduate and postgraduate levels. It offers courses in various disciplines like business, education, and arts. DSU offers degrees from the associate to doctoral levels and certificate programs through 4 schools and colleges namely the College of Arts & Sciences, College of Business and Information Systems, The Beacom College of Computer and Cyber Sciences, and the College of Education.

Dakota State University offers a wide range of programs to its students. The programs offered include business administration, art, artificial intelligence, and computer education. Over 40 undergraduate and graduate programs, seven associate degrees, and 21 certificate programs are offered through its four colleges.
Dakota State University has a selective admission policy. Students are required to apply online on the website and pay the application fees. International students also need to appear for the English language proficiency test. In the table below are some programs offered at DSU and their details:
